| Abstract: | We examine the recent literature that studies the spatial distribution of economic activity across both space and time. We discuss the methodological advances enabling the incorporation of dynamic forces of economic activity---such as endogenous innovation, forward-looking location choices, capital and asset accumulation, idea diffusion, and stochastic fundamentals---into frameworks with many heterogeneous locations and a rich economic geography. These frameworks remain tractable for quantitative evaluations. We also discuss the wide range of empirical questions explored in recent work through the lens of these frameworks, including the global and local economic impacts of climate change, the dynamic effects of trade and migration policy, labor market adjustments to import competition, the spatial consequences of structural change, the dynamic effects of place-based policies, and the long-run spatial effects of large-scale infrastructure projects. |

| Abstract: | How do environmental goods and policies shape spatial patterns of economic activity? How will climate change modify these impacts over the coming decades? How do agglomeration, commuting, and other spatial forces and policies affect environmental quality? We distill theoretical and empirical research linking urban, regional, and spatial economics to the environment. We present stylized facts on spatial environmental economics, describe insights from canonical environmental models and spatial models, and discuss the building blocks for papers and the research frontier in enviro-spatial economics. Most enviro-spatial research remains bifurcated into either primarily environmental or spatial papers. Research is only beginning to realize potential insights from more closely combining spatial and environmental approaches. |

| Abstract: | The high return to human capital on GDP per capita, reaching up to 50% in simple cross country or region regressions, is puzzling. We develop a spatial model with both rural regions and cities. Both human capital and the concentration of employment in city centers drive knowledge spillovers. Regional land prices clear the market for inter-regional labor mobility, leading to joint predictions for the public return to human capital and land prices. We test the model using data on wages and real-estate prices for 47 U.S. rural areas and 34 CMSAs from 1979 to 2015. We find that the public return on wages is 30% of the private return in rural regions, rising to 150% in cities. The total (public + private) return to human capital on GDP per capita is 20%. Increased knowledge spillovers account for the full real wage growth and for most of the increase in house prices in this period. Regional sorting of human capital and the city form each account for 15% of GDP. |

| Abstract: | The idea that people want to go to where the jobs are is intuitive, yet is absent from the standard quantitative spatial modelling approach in which location choices are guided by prices, without reference to quantities (the number of jobs in a place). The purpose of this paper is to fill this gap by making jobs, as well as places, the objects of household choice. This involves minor change to the modelling approach used in the literature and provides a simple description of labour market matching. Similar modification of the modelling of firms’ location choices captures the idea that these are shaped by both wage costs and the availability of workers with appropriate skill. These modifications yield powerful agglomeration forces, as workers’ location choices become positively influenced by the number of jobs in a place, and firms’ decision are shaped by the number of workers with appropriate skills. Results are established analytically and in a regional model in which the equilibrium distributions of workers and sectors are demonstrated. |

| Abstract: | Using administrative data from Germany, we document that high-wage locations have substantially lower labor shares and higher wage dispersion. We show that a parsimonious model, in which firm monopsony power stems from search frictions in local labor markets, can explain these facts as long as “superstar†firms sort into productive locations. This positive sorting, which emerges as the unique equilibrium if firm and location productivity are sufficient complements or labor market frictions are sufficiently large, steepens the local wage ladder in productive locations and leads to not only higher wages, but also greater wage inequality. At the same time, positive firm sorting reduces local labor shares in prosperous places because more productive firms have more monopsony power. Our estimated model indicates that firm sorting can rationalize the lower local labor shares in regions with endogenously higher wages and can account for 40% of their increased wage dispersion. In spatial firm sorting, we thus highlight a new source of disparities in local labor market outcomes. |

| Abstract: | The recent development of quantitative urban models provides a new set of tools for evaluating transport improvements. Conventional cost-benefit analyses are typically undertaken in partial equilibrium. In contrast, quantitative urban models characterize the spatial distribution of economic activity within cities in general equilibrium. We compare evaluations of a transport improvement using conventional cost-benefit analysis, sufficient statistics approaches based on changes in market access, and model-based counterfactuals. We show that quantitative urban models predict a reorganization of economic activity within cities in response to a transport improvement, which can lead to substantial differences between the predictions of these three approaches for large changes in transport costs. |

| Abstract: | This paper investigates how demographic, socioeconomic, and second-nature geographic factors jointly shape the emergence, spatial distribution, and heterogeneity of left-behind places (LBPs) in Spain. Using municipal-level data, it develops an empirical strategy combining cluster analysis, frontier analysis, and a multinomial logit model to identify distinct types of territorial vulnerability, to measure how close municipalities are to transitioning into more disadvantaged states, and to estimate the probability of belonging to specific LBP categories. The results reveal substantial heterogeneity across left-behind places, uncovering multiple forms of municipal vulnerability. A central contribution is the explicit incorporation of second-nature geography into the clustering procedure itself rather than treating geography as a merely contextual or ex post factor. These variables emerge as critical drivers of territorial disadvantage, and their inclusion leads to the reclassification of nearly 20% of Spanish municipalities, uncovering forms of hidden marginality that would remain invisible in analyses based solely on demographic and socioeconomic characteristics. From a policy perspective, the findings support a shift toward what the authors term systemic place-based policies; forward-looking strategies that seek to reshape the spatial preconditions for economic activity rather than simply adapting to existing territorial structures. |

| Abstract: | Using oil and gas shocks as an exogenous source of business cycles at the U.S. commuting zone level, we provide novel evidence that local booms increase local patenting, especially in non-metropolitan areas. This reflects agglomeration economies that make incumbent inventors more productive. In contrast to total patenting, innovation in oil and gas — the sector closest to the boom — is countercyclical, consistent with higher opportunity costs of innovation in a booming industry. Our findings shed new light on the spatial dimension of innovation, inform recent debates on place-based industrial policy, and help to reconcile mixed evidence on the cyclicality of innovation. |

| Abstract: | Given the Cultural and Creative Industries' (CCIs) growing contribution to Italy's GDP and their fragmented structure of small-medium enterprises, this paper explores the impact of agglomeration on Italian province productivity. To overcome the Modifiable Areal Unit Problem (MAUP) inherent in administrative boundaries, we employ a distance-based specialization index to assess whether firms benefit from operating in close proximity to peers within the same industry. We replicate this analysis at both the domain level (Cultural vs Creative) and the macro-sector level (e.g., Architecture and Design, Performing Arts). Our findings reveal a positive effect of agglomeration on Total Factor Productivity (TFP) across all levels of aggregation. However, when utilizing value added per employee as a metric for productivity, the positive impact is exclusively significant at the macro-sector level, dissipating at more aggregated domain classifications. These results underscore the necessity of facilitating co-location policies for CCIs, particularly given their SME-dominated nature. |

| Abstract: | This paper analyses how trade influences intra-regional income inequality across Europe’s NUTS-2 regions. Drawing on newly compiled datasets capturing both inter-regional trade and local-level inequality for all EU member states plus the UK, we employ an econometric framework —complete with Instrumental Variable estimations and robust sensitivity analyses— to gauge the impact of trade on regional interpersonal inequality. In addition to examining aggregate trade, we distinguish between various trade channels, including exchanges within the EU versus those with the rest of the world, links to neighbouring regions versus non-neighbours, and domestic versus international flows. Our findings reveal that higher levels of trade are positively associated with changes in regional income inequality, as measured by the Gini coefficient. Crucially, this link depends on trading partners: trade within a single country, within the EU, and with non-neighbouring regions correlates with rising inequality, whereas international trade, trade with non-EU partners, or trade with neighbouring regions shows no statistically significant effect. These conclusions withstand a battery of robustness checks, including new control variables and a population-weighted approach, further underscoring the role that particular types of trade play in shaping regional income disparities. |

| Abstract: | This study examines how regional technological relatedness and local AI knowledge influence regional innovative activity, as measured by patenting activity. Using a novel three-way longitudinal dataset (670 four-digit CPC classes × 302 NUTS-2 regions × nine four-year periods, 1986-2021) and leveraging a deep learning-based identification of AI patents, we show that two broad mechanisms operate in parallel. First, in accordance with the extant literature, technologies that are cognitively close to a region's existing patent portfolio enjoy higher patenting activity, confirming that relatedness remains a strong and persistent predictor of innovative output. Second, local AI endowments are positively associated with patenting across technological fields, even after conditioning on relatedness, indicating that AI plays an enabling and cross-cutting role in a given regional innovation system. Moreover, the interaction between relatedness and AI turns out to be negative and statistically significant, implying that AI attenuates the extent to which local innovative efforts depend on the technology's proximity to the regional portfolio. In sum, AI appears to enhance overall local innovative activity while reducing its reliance on pre-existing regional knowledge structures. |

| Abstract: | Accurate and timely regional economic data is crucial for effective policymaking and informed decision-making at all levels. Understanding the economic performance of different regions and countries within the UK allows policymakers to identify areas of strength and weakness, target support to those most in need, and develop policies that promote balanced and sustainable growth. Businesses can also use this information to make informed decisions about investment, expansion, and resource allocation. In recent years, the UK Office for National Statistics (ONS) has significantly invested in the development of new and novel sub-national statistics to support economic analysis and insight at a regional and country level. One of these innovations was the introduction of experimental Quarterly Country and Regional Gross Domestic Product (QCRGDP) estimates in 2019. These aimed to provide detailed, timely insights into economic performance at a regional level. However, despite initial success, the series faced some challenges that led to a temporary suspension in 2023. ESCoE was then commissioned to complete a review of its methods and processes. This report provides findings from the review, showing how the experimental nature of the series, coupled with its reliance on administrative data, gave rise to some challenges. It then outlines several recommendations to address these issues and rebuild user confidence. |

| Abstract: | We use high-resolution spatial data to build a novel global annual gridded GDP dataset at 1°, 0.5°, and 0.25° resolutions from 2012 onward. Our random forest model trained on local and national GDP achieves an R² above 0.92 for GDP levels and above 0.62 for annual changes in regions left out of the training sample. By incorporating diverse indicators beyond population and nighttime lights, our estimates offer more precise subnational GDP measurements for analyzing economic shocks, local policies, and regional disparities. We evaluate the precision of our estimates with a sample case of COVID-19’s impact on local GDP in China. |

| Abstract: | The development of the digital economy has the potential to impact resource allocation efficiency within a region. This study examines the direct and spatial effects of digital economy development on the location choice of foreign direct investment (FDI) in Chinese cities. The findings indicate that digital economy development not only enhances the inflow of foreign direct investment within a region but also influences FDI inflows in neighboring regions, with spillover effects diminishing as geographical distance increases. To address endogeneity concerns, staggered Difference-inDifferences (DID) and spatial DID models are introduced in an event study to validate our main findings. Moreover, regional heterogeneity analysis reveals that the impact of digital economy development on FDI location decisions is particularly significant in eastern and coastal cities. The results offer an empirical foundation for emerging market countries, such as China, to advance sustainable digital economy development, enhance resource allocation efficiency, and support foreign investors in making informed investment location decisions. |

| Abstract: | This paper shows how the local labor market (LLM) responds to changes in touristic attractiveness, leveraging a unique classification of Italian localities based on their main touristic assets and aggregate trends in foreign tourists' choices in a shift-share research design. Looking at all LLMs, we find a strong positive relationship between changes in attractiveness and changes in the local tourism-related economic activity, tourism expenditure, and tourism employment, but no effect on total employment. In high-unemployment LLMs, however, we find a sizable overall employment effect and large indirect effects generated through industries related to tourism and firms in the nontradable sector. |

| Abstract: | We document variations in real income for high-skilled, low-skilled, and rural migrant households across Chinese cities. Using comprehensive data on land parcel transactions along with individual data for land development and household expenditure, we construct a city-specific housing cost index and assess how it varies across locations. All three components of housing costs –unit land prices, land share in construction, and housing share in expenditure– decrease from city centres to the periphery, increase with city population, and decrease with city land area, as predicted by theory. Overall, housing costs in China are high and vary widely between locations. While income gains outweigh housing costs when moving from smaller to larger cities, in the largest cities, housing costs begin to dominate, particularly for low-skilled and rural migrant households. This suggests a bell-shaped relationship between real income and city population in China, aligning with theoretical predictions. |
